    What did u use to wash the chicken?

    • @momstrinicooking4449
      @momstrinicooking4449  4 роки тому

      Hi! this depends on where you buy your meat. For me, I live in Canada and buy my whole soft chickens at larger department stores where they are fairly clean, so I would just use water after I finish cutting it. On the other hand, other meats require different types of cleaning. Things you can use to clean your chicken is water, vinegar, lime, flour. I personally do not like to use lime, flour and vinegar in my soft chickens because it toughen the meat up. I hope this explanation helps you. Let me know what you decide to do.
